1/31/2023 0 Comments Google chrome automatically closes![]() ![]() If resetting Chrome doesn’t fix the error, try changing the Default subfolder’s title to something else. Enter ‘default_old’ as the new folder title, and press the Return key.Right-click the Default subfolder and select Rename.Then browse to this folder path: C: > Users > (user account) > AppData > Local > Google > Chrome > User Data.Select the Hidden Items checkbox on the View tab shown directly below. ![]()
